大孔吸附树脂对高粱泡鲜果红色素的吸附与洗脱性能  被引量:8

The Adsorption and Desorption Properties of Macro-porous Resins for Red Pigment from Fruit of Rubus lambertianus Ser.

摘  要:探讨了高粱泡果实红色素的提取条件及大孔吸附树脂对其吸附和洗脱特性.结果表明,高粱泡果实红色素的最适提取剂为酸性EtOH.3种大孔树脂中,X-5型树脂对高粱泡果实红色素的吸附和洗脱性能较好,吸附率达96.17%,解吸率为94.40%,适宜用作高梁泡果实红色素的分离、纯化;适当的色素液浓度、流速、NaCl质量分数及温度均可增大X-5型树脂对色素的吸附率,而用80%~95%EtOH作为洗脱剂,洗脱效果最好.The extraction conditions, the adsorption and desorption properties of macro-porous adsorption resin for the red pigment from Rubus lambertianus fruit were analyzed. The results showed that the best extraction solution was acid ethanol. The X-5 resin had a good ability of adsorption and elution for red pigment in 3 macro-porous adsorption resin. The adsorption rate was up to 96.17%, and the elution rate was 94.4%. X-5 macro-porous adsorption resin was suitable to isolate and purify the red pigment. At a proper concentration of pigment and NaCl, velocity flow and temperature, the adsorption rate of the X-5 macro-porous may be somewhat increased. The desorption rate was best when the concentration of Ethanol was 80%~90%.
